Ingredients You’ll Need for This Crispy Mashed Potato Cheese Puffs

The key to this dish lies in selecting the right ingredients that complement the creamy mashed potatoes without overpowering them. I always recommend using good-quality cheese—something with a bit of sharpness like aged cheddar—to give these puffs that irresistible flavor punch. Fresh herbs can add a lovely brightness, but don’t worry if you don’t have any on hand; the cheese and potatoes do most of the heavy lifting. When I was growing up, simplicity was king, and that’s exactly what these puffs deliver.

  • 2 cups leftover mashed potatoes (preferably chilled)
  • 1 cup shredded sharp cheddar cheese
  • 1/4 cup grated Parmesan cheese
  • 1/2 cup all-purpose flour
  • 1 large egg, beaten
  • 2 tablespoons chopped fresh chives or spring onions (optional)
  • Salt and freshly ground black pepper, to taste
  • Vegetable oil, for frying

If you need to swap, you can use mozzarella or gruyère instead of cheddar for a milder or nuttier flavor. For a gluten-free option, try almond flour or a gluten-free flour blend, though the texture may vary slightly.

Instructions

  1. Start by placing the leftover mashed potatoes in a large mixing bowl. Add the shredded cheddar, Parmesan, flour, beaten egg, and chopped chives if using.
  2. Season with salt and pepper, then mix everything together until you have a smooth, pliable dough. If it feels too sticky, add a little more flour, a tablespoon at a time.
  3. Heat about 2 inches of vegetable oil in a deep pan or fryer to 350°F (175°C). Use a candy or deep-fry thermometer to keep the temperature steady.
  4. Using a tablespoon or small cookie scoop, form the mixture into bite-sized balls and gently lower them into the hot oil. Don’t overcrowd the pan—fry in batches for that perfect crisp.
  5. Fry the puffs for 3-4 minutes, turning occasionally, until they’re golden brown and crispy on all sides.
  6. Use a slotted spoon to transfer the puffs to a plate lined with paper towels to drain excess oil.
  7. Serve warm, ideally within 15 minutes for the best texture and flavor.

One tip I picked up working in busy kitchens is to keep your oil temperature consistent; too hot and they’ll burn outside but stay raw inside, too cool and they soak up oil and become greasy.

Tips for Making the Best Crispy Mashed Potato Cheese Puffs

Getting these puffs just right is all about technique and a bit of love. I’ve found that attention to detail at every stage—from mixing to frying—makes a huge difference in the final result. When my kids were younger, I’d let them help shape the puffs, which made the process a joyful mess and created memories beyond the plate.

  • Use cold, day-old mashed potatoes for better texture—freshly made mash can be too soft and sticky.
  • Don’t skip the flour—it’s essential for binding and achieving that crisp crust.
  • Chilling the formed puffs in the fridge for 15 minutes before frying helps them hold their shape.
  • Maintain a consistent oil temperature around 350°F to ensure even cooking.
  • Drain fried puffs on paper towels to avoid sogginess.
  • Feel free to experiment with cheeses and herbs to make the recipe your own.

Storage and Reheating Tips

Proper storage ensures you can enjoy leftovers just as much as the fresh dish. These puffs tend to lose their crispness over time, but with a few simple tricks, you can revive them beautifully.

  • Store in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days
  • Reheat in a preheated oven at 375°F (190°C) on a baking sheet for 8-10 minutes to restore crispness
  • Avoid microwaving, as it will make the puffs soggy
  • Make ahead and freeze uncooked puffs on a tray, then transfer to a freezer bag; fry straight from frozen, adding a minute or two to cooking time
